Another track from the 1983 group EZ Pickin' that Debra was a part of in the early 1980s. Written by Duke Ellington and showcases Paul Blackwell on lead vocal.

credits

released March 15, 1983
Paul Blackwell: Mandolin, vocals
Debra Cowan: Vocals
Ron Johnson: Guitar
Rick Hobbs: Guitar
Scott Joss: Fiddle
Julie Smyres: Bass

Debra Cowan Shrewsbury, Massachusetts

Singer Debra Cowan performs a cappella and with guitar, interpreting a wide range of folk songs. Debra has two acclaimed solo recordings to her credit, and her third, “Fond Desire Farewell” was produced by former Fairport Convention drummer Dave Mattacks. A former California resident, she now resides in Massachusetts and tours all over North America and the United Kingdom. ... more
